java怎么将按钮信息转化为文本框

   2025-02-15 5360
核心提示:在Java中,可以使用ActionListener接口来监听按钮的点击事件,并在点击事件发生时将按钮信息转化为文本框。首先,需要创建一个按

在Java中,可以使用ActionListener接口来监听按钮的点击事件,并在点击事件发生时将按钮信息转化为文本框。

首先,需要创建一个按钮和一个文本框对象,并将其添加到窗口中。例如:

import javax.swing.JButton;import javax.swing.JFrame;import javax.swing.JTextField;public class ButtonToTextFieldExample {    public static void main(String[] args) {        // 创建窗口        JFrame frame = new JFrame("Button to TextField Example");        fr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);                // 创建按钮和文本框        JButton button = new JButton("Click Me");        JTextField textField = new JTextField();                // 设置按钮的点击事件监听器        button.addActionListener(e -> {            // 将按钮的文本内容设置为文本框的文本内容            textField.setText(button.getText());        });                // 将按钮和文本框添加到窗口中        frame.getContentPane().add(button, BorderLayout.NORTH);        frame.getContentPane().add(textField, BorderLayout.SOUTH);                // 设置窗口大小和可见性        frame.setSize(300, 200);        frame.setVisible(true);    }}

在上面的代码中,我们使用Lambda表达式来定义按钮的点击事件监听器。在点击事件发生时,将按钮的文本内容设置为文本框的文本内容。

通过运行上述代码,当点击按钮时,按钮的文本内容将会显示在文本框中。

 
 
更多>同类维修知识
推荐图文
推荐维修知识
点击排行
网站首页  |  关于我们  |  联系方式  |  用户协议  |  隐私政策  |  网站留言